Confirmation: Robert F. Kennedy, Jr., of California, to be Secretary of Health and Human Services
February 13, 2025 · On the Nomination
Senator John Fetterman voted Nay on this measure. On this vote, Fetterman voted with the majority of the Senate Democratic caucus. The final result was Nomination Confirmed (52–48).
